A Crown Heights resident and his son who were struck by a deer late Sunday afternoon while riding on a motorbike, are expected to return home Monday.
“Hopefully we will be discharged today,” the father and businessman wrote to COLlive.com from the Westchester Medical Center in NY, where he is currently hospitalized.
In a text message received Jul 11, 2011 11:18 AM, he wrote: “Boruch Hashem, myself and my son Moshe are doing great and there seems to be no serious problems.”
The two, both wearing helmets, were hit in front of Luxor Estates in the town of Loch Sheldrake. Hatzolah Paramedics requested a chopper to respond for the child who had a head injury, to be flown to a trauma center, CatskillScoop.com reported.
The father asked COLlive, “Please post that all is good and that all the Tehillim helped.”
